Node.js是什么,它是用来做什么的?

发布网友 发布时间:2022-03-24 20:11

我来回答

4个回答

懂视网 时间:2022-03-25 00:33

node.js能做的是:

  

  1、node.js是一个运行在chromeJavascript运行环境下(俗称GoogleV8引擎)的开发平台,用来方便快捷的创建服务器端网络应用程序。可以把它理解为一个轻量级的JSP或PHP环境,但是用来开发Web应用,有时要便捷很多。

  

  2、一般认为javascript是浏览器端的脚本语言,但是google将其再开发,用来作为服务器端脚本环境,其性能自称比Python、Perl、PHP还要快。

  

  3、node.js的最大优点是处理并行访问,如果一个web应用程序同时会有很多访问连接,就能体现使用node.js的优势。

  

  4、另一个好处是,使用javascript作为服务器端脚本语言,可以消除一些与浏览器端js脚本的冲突。甚至发挥javascript动态编程的特性,在服务器与浏览器之间建立直接的动态程序。

  

  

热心网友 时间:2022-03-24 21:41

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行时。
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境。 Node.js 使用了一个事件驱动、非阻塞式 I/O 的模型。
Node 是一个让 JavaScript 运行在服务端的开发平台,它让 JavaScript 成为与PHP、Python、Perl、Ruby 等服务端语言平起平坐的脚本语言。 [2] 发布于2009年5月,由Ryan Dahl开发,实质是对Chrome V8引擎进行了封装。
Node对一些特殊用例进行优化,提供替代的API,使得V8在非浏览器环境下运行得更好。V8引擎执行Javascript的速度非常快,性能非常好。Node是一个基于Chrome JavaScript运行时建立的平台, 用于方便地搭建响应速度快、易于扩展的网络应用。Node 使用事件驱动, 非阻塞I/O 模型而得以轻量和高效,非常适合在分布式设备上运行数据密集型的实时应用。

热心网友 时间:2022-03-24 22:59

简称node,是一个JavaScript库,简单来说,node的出现是一场*,非常适合在分布式设备上运行数据密集型的实时应用,node我感觉是必学的吧,我学的时候也只学node的一个部分: express。

热心网友 时间:2022-03-25 00:33

写服务端,js成为主流的语言之一,

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com